Removal and Installation

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2006 Mercury Mariner and 2006 Ford Escape.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Disconnect the battery ground cable. For additional information, refer to BATTERY, MOUNTING AND CABLES .
  2. Disconnect the accelerator pedal electrical connector.
  3. Remove the 3 bolts and release the accelerator pedal from the locating/retaining tabs on the lower RH corner of the accelerator pedal mounting bracket.
    • To install, tighten to 9 Nm (80 lb-in).
  4. To install, reverse the removal procedure.
    • Verify that the accelerator pedal and sensor assembly is engaged in the locating/retaining tabs of the accelerator pedal mounting bracket prior to installing the bolts.
